UAE and US Congress Aides Discuss Strengthening Bilateral Ties

Dr. Ali Rashid Al Nuaimi, the Chairman of the Defence Affairs, Interior and Foreign Affairs Committee at the Federal National Council (FNC), engaged with a delegation of aides from the United States Congress led by Morgan Cintron. Their visit aimed to foster stronger dialogue and collaboration between the UAE and the US.

Welcoming the American representatives, Dr. Al Nuaimi pointed out the significance of such visits in nurturing parliamentary ties. He noted that the rapport between the FNC and the US Congress bolsters legislative exchanges and enhances mutual understanding. This meeting exemplified the rising role of parliamentary diplomacy in forming resilient international partnerships.

In their discussions, Dr. Al Nuaimi shared insights into the UAE's advancements in governance, development, and innovation. He underscored the nation’s success in cultivating a sustainable economy alongside its focus on health, education, and technology. Furthermore, he highlighted how the leadership's emphasis on human development serves as a beacon of growth and stability within the region.

Additionally, Dr. Al Nuaimi celebrated the empowerment of Emirati women, acknowledging their essential roles in varied sectors such as business, politics, and public service. Their rising influence exemplifies the UAE’s commitment to equality and enabling every citizen's participation in national achievements.

Promoting tolerance and coexistence was another focal point of the meeting. Dr. Al Nuaimi articulated how the UAE fosters respect among diverse cultures and religions, cultivating a harmonious society inclusive of over 200 nationalities. This vision aligns with the UAE’s enduring aspirations for global unity.

He commended the United States for its efforts in advancing global peace and stability, particularly its initiatives amid conflicts. In light of the Gaza situation, he reiterated the necessity for ongoing collaboration to achieve political resolutions that safeguard civilians and facilitate humanitarian assistance.

Dr. Al Nuaimi also emphasized the importance of the Abraham Accords in forging new avenues for cooperation across the Middle East. He stated that these accords have sparked dialogue within various communities, contributing to peace and economic progress. The UAE’s commitment to these accords further illustrates its dedication to regional stability.

Both parties expressed a shared commitment to continuing their collaborative endeavors. The US representatives lauded the UAE’s balanced approach to foreign affairs and its vital role in promoting peace regionally and globally.

To conclude, Dr. Al Nuaimi affirmed that ongoing dialogue between the UAE and the United States reinforces the groundwork for future partnership. By exchanging experiences and appreciating each other’s viewpoints, both nations can further advance global peace, security, and prosperity.
